What an Out-of-Date HazCom Program Actually Costs
Hazard Communication has sat near the top of OSHA's most-cited standards list for years, and the pattern behind most of those citations is almost always the same, an inventory that no longer matches what is physically on site, a Safety Data Sheet that was never updated after a supplier reformulated a product, or a label that fell off a secondary container and never got replaced. None of these require a plant to be careless about chemical safety in general, they require only that the system tracking chemicals stop keeping pace with what actually changes week to week. Purchasing adds a new adhesive without EHS knowing, a supplier reformulates a coolant and issues a revised SDS that never reaches the binder, a contractor brings in a cleaning product that never enters the facility's own inventory at all. Each gap is small on its own, but auditors rarely find just one, because a facility whose inventory has drifted in one area has usually let it drift everywhere.

The Five Requirements a Compliant Program Has to Cover
OSHA's Hazard Communication Standard, 29 CFR 1910.1200, builds a compliant program out of five interlocking pieces. Skipping any one of them, even while the other four look solid, is enough to draw a citation, because an auditor who finds a gap in one area typically starts checking the others more closely.
Written HazCom Program
A documented plan covering how the facility handles labeling, SDS access, and training, kept current as processes change.
Chemical Inventory
A complete, accurate list of every hazardous chemical on site, including anything brought in by contractors.
GHS Container Labeling
Every primary and secondary container carries the required pictograms, signal word, and hazard statements.
SDS Access & Currency
A current 16-section SDS for every listed chemical, reachable by any employee at any point in a shift.
Storage CategorySegregation RequirementCommon Manufacturing ExamplePrimary Risk if Co-Stored
Flammable LiquidsRated flammable cabinet, away from ignition sourcesSolvents, degreasers, adhesivesFire, vapor ignition
OxidizersSeparated from flammables and organicsCertain cleaning concentrates, some coolantsRapid combustion, explosion
CorrosivesAcid and base cabinets kept separate from each otherPlating and etching chemicals, battery acidViolent reaction, toxic gas release
Compressed GasesSecured upright, oxidizing gases away from fuel gasesWelding gases, refrigerants, nitrogenCylinder failure, explosive mixture

Matching PPE to the Actual Hazard, Not a Generic Chemical List
A single blanket PPE rule, gloves and goggles for every chemical task, is easier to write into a procedure than it is to actually keep workers safe with, because different hazard classes call for genuinely different protection. Skin contact hazards from a corrosive need a different glove material than a solvent that permeates standard nitrile within minutes, and a task generating vapors above the exposure limit needs respiratory protection that a splash-rated apron does nothing to provide. Treating every chemical task under one generic PPE rule is a common shortcut, and it is also one of the more dangerous ones, since it creates the appearance of protection without actually matching the equipment to the route of exposure the SDS describes for that specific product.
Skin Contact
Glove material is selected against the specific chemical's permeation and breakthrough time, not a generic nitrile default.
Inhalation
Respirator selection follows measured or estimated exposure against the chemical's permissible exposure limit.
Eye & Face
Splash goggles for liquid handling, face shields added where a reaction or spray risk is present.
Body Protection
Chemical-resistant aprons or suits are matched to the SDS-listed hazard class, not assumed from the task alone.
Spill Response, From First Notice to Closed Incident
STEP 1
Contain & Alert
Stop the spread with available containment, alert nearby workers, and pull the relevant SDS for exposure and reactivity guidance.
STEP 2
Evacuate If Needed
Any spill exceeding the trained team's capacity or releasing vapors above safe levels triggers evacuation, not an attempted cleanup.
STEP 3
Clean Up With Matched PPE
Trained responders in PPE matched to the specific chemical's hazard class perform containment and cleanup per the written procedure.
STEP 4
Dispose & Document
Waste is disposed of per regulatory requirements, and the event is logged with root cause review, not just a cleanup confirmation.
Spill kits stationed near the storage areas most likely to need them, matched to the specific hazard classes stored there rather than one generic kit for the whole plant, make the difference between an event that stays contained and one that spreads before anyone reaches the right absorbent material.

What is the difference between GHS and HazCom?
GHS, the Globally Harmonized System, is the international standard for classifying chemical hazards and communicating them through consistent labels and a standardized 16-section Safety Data Sheet format. HazCom is OSHA's US regulation, 29 CFR 1910.1200, which adopts GHS as the framework employers must follow domestically. In practice the two terms are often used together, since a US facility's HazCom program is built directly on GHS classification and formatting requirements, and staying current with GHS revisions is how a facility stays compliant with the underlying HazCom standard.
How often does a Safety Data Sheet need to be updated?
There is no fixed calendar requirement, but most guidance recommends a review every three to five years even without a known change, and an update within ninety days whenever new hazard information becomes available from the manufacturer. In practice, the more common failure is not missing a scheduled review, it is missing a supplier reformulation or a new hazard classification that should have triggered an update outside the normal cycle. Who is responsible for SDS documentation on contractor-supplied chemicals?
The host employer is generally responsible for ensuring that a current SDS is accessible for every hazardous chemical present on the premises, including chemicals brought in by a cleaning crew, a maintenance contractor, or any other outside vendor. Missing SDS documentation for a contractor-supplied chemical is one of the most frequently cited HazCom violations, precisely because it falls into a gap between the contractor's own program and the host facility's inventory. A written agreement clarifying which party maintains which records closes most of this gap before it becomes a citation.
What should a chemical inventory actually include?
A compliant inventory lists every hazardous chemical present on site by the name that matches its SDS and label, along with whether a current SDS is on file and the manufacturer's contact information. The inventory does not need to restate the specific hazards of each chemical, since those live on the SDS and label themselves, but it does need to be complete and current enough that an auditor or an emergency responder can trust it. Why do PPE recommendations vary so much between different chemicals?
Different hazard classes attack the body through different routes, a corrosive threatens skin and eyes on contact, a volatile solvent threatens the respiratory system through vapor, and no single glove material or respirator cartridge protects equally well against all of them. Selecting PPE against the specific hazard class and exposure route listed on each chemical's SDS, rather than applying one blanket rule across every task, is what keeps protection actually matched to the risk. A generic PPE policy is often the reason a worker is technically wearing protective equipment and still gets exposed.
